The Trusts Sport Waitakere Excellence Awards are the premier sports awards for West Auckland. The awards celebrate the success and achievement of West Auckland in the sporting arena across all roles in sport. This is the 21st year the awards have taken place and are the only awards in the region that include the celebration of secondary schools.

WHERE'S WALLY Our Performing Arts Academy students put on a wonderful performance at the Where's Wally evening on Thursday evening. Students from the Dance, Drama, Classical and Jazz strands showcased their year's learning in the performing arts, taking the audience on a journey around the world as they referenced the adventures of the elusive traveller, Wally.
